Output 56b5c3cdf2e3a54e078a085ace468d8607d65206e1b2c3a399b5d26976474675:0

value
672538
script pubkey
OP_0 OP_PUSHBYTES_20 45cd08f68d734b33e883321fef98aa3933377fef
address
bc1qghxs3a5dwd9n86yrxg07lx928yenwll0p7wm5g
transaction
56b5c3cdf2e3a54e078a085ace468d8607d65206e1b2c3a399b5d26976474675
confirmations
138059
spent
true